Skip to content

Conversation

@fishwww-ww
Copy link
Contributor

No description provided.

@gru-agent
Copy link
Contributor

gru-agent bot commented Oct 23, 2025

TestGru Assignment

Summary

Link CommitId Status Reason
Detail f052bb6 ✅ Finished

History Assignment

Files

File Pull Request
projects/app/src/components/core/app/formRender/utils.ts ❌ Failed (Something wrong with the environment: The test runner cannot resolve the import path '../../../../projects/app/src/components/core/app/formRender/utils' from the test file. This is an environmental/configuration issue, not a source code bug. The test code and source code are correct, but the test cannot run due to incorrect or missing file resolution in the test environment.)

Tip

You can @gru-agent and leave your feedback. TestGru will make adjustments based on your input

@github-actions
Copy link

github-actions bot commented Oct 23, 2025

Preview mcp_server Image:

registry.cn-hangzhou.aliyuncs.com/fastgpt/fastgpt-pr:fatsgpt_mcp_server_be7722433f01edc2e7d51e4d9daf1bbb9055aaf1

@github-actions
Copy link

github-actions bot commented Oct 23, 2025

Preview sandbox Image:

registry.cn-hangzhou.aliyuncs.com/fastgpt/fastgpt-pr:fatsgpt_sandbox_be7722433f01edc2e7d51e4d9daf1bbb9055aaf1

@github-actions
Copy link

github-actions bot commented Oct 23, 2025

Preview fastgpt Image:

registry.cn-hangzhou.aliyuncs.com/fastgpt/fastgpt-pr:fatsgpt_be7722433f01edc2e7d51e4d9daf1bbb9055aaf1

@c121914yu c121914yu changed the base branch from main to v4.14.0-dev October 23, 2025 06:14
@cursor
Copy link

cursor bot commented Oct 23, 2025

This PR is being reviewed by Cursor Bugbot

Details

You are on the Bugbot Free tier. On this plan, Bugbot will review limited PRs each billing cycle.

To receive Bugbot reviews on all of your PRs, visit the Cursor dashboard to activate Pro and start your 14-day free trial.

@cursor
Copy link

cursor bot commented Oct 23, 2025

Bug: Unintended Debugging Artifacts Committed

Two debugging artifacts, a stray 1; statement and a console.log call, appear to have been accidentally committed and serve no functional purpose.

Additional Locations (1)

Fix in Cursor Fix in Web

@cursor
Copy link

cursor bot commented Oct 23, 2025

Bug: TimeInput Component Redundant Date Formatting

The TimeInput component unnecessarily formats startDate and endDate with formatTime2YMDHMS before creating a Date object. This redundant step can cause parsing issues or precision loss, potentially leading to invalid date values in the time range selector.

Fix in Cursor Fix in Web

@cursor
Copy link

cursor bot commented Oct 23, 2025

Bug: Date Parsing Error Causes Formatting Issues

The new Date(data.timePointDefault || '') expression can create an invalid Date object if data.timePointDefault is falsy. This invalid date, when passed to formatTime2YMDHMS, may cause unexpected results or runtime errors.

Fix in Cursor Fix in Web

@cursor
Copy link

cursor bot commented Oct 23, 2025

Bug: Redundant Date Formatting Causes Parsing Errors

Unnecessary and potentially error-prone date formatting: The code calls formatTime2YMDHMS(startDate) to format a date to string, then immediately creates a new Date from that string with new Date(formatTime2YMDHMS(startDate)). This double conversion could introduce parsing errors and is redundant. If startDate needs to be a Date object, it should be converted directly without the intermediate string formatting.

Additional Locations (1)

Fix in Cursor Fix in Web

@cursor
Copy link

cursor bot commented Oct 23, 2025

Bug: Stale State in Asynchronous Callback

The handleAddUrl function uses stale state in the onChange callback. It calls onChange([...urlFileList, trimmedUrl]) immediately after setUrlFileList((prev) => [...prev, trimmedUrl]), but since state updates are asynchronous, urlFileList still contains the old value. This causes the parent component to receive an incomplete file list. The fix should be to use the new array value: const newList = [...urlFileList, trimmedUrl]; setUrlFileList(newList); onChange(newList);

Fix in Cursor Fix in Web

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ants